Exploring Graph Databases

When Exploring Graph Databases, it’s super important to understand their structure and use cases. Graph databases excel in managing interconnected data and are efficient in representing complex relationships. Here are some key points to consider:

  • Graph databases use nodes, edges, and properties to represent and store data.
  • They offer high performance for queries related to relationship-heavy data.
  • Neo4j stands out as one of the most popular graph databases, known for its scalability and developer-friendly features.

Showing the Most Popular Graph Database

When it comes to graph databases, Neo4j stands out as one of the most popular choices in the market.

With its strong features and versatile capabilities, Neo4j has solidified its position as a top contender for organizations looking to use the power of graph technology.

Some key reasons why Neo4j has gained immense popularity include:

  • Scalability: Neo4j offers seamless scalability, allowing organizations to manage and query large amounts of interconnected data with ease.
  • Performance: The graph database’s efficient query processing enables quick retrieval of complex relationships, improving total performance.
  • Flexibility: Neo4j provides flexibility in data modeling, making it suitable for a wide range of use cases across various industries.
  • Community Support: With a lively and active community, users can access resources, documentation, and support to maximize their Neo4j experience.
